And on The script should be as detailed as possible. It should include direction about the shot, whether it's medium, wide, or a close up. Specify whether it is a static shot or if dollies, pans, pull outs or camera moves are involved. The point is that this is the time that choices will need to be made - not on the set when you're shooting at your video. People will get impatient if you wait until you are in production and the time will their explanation slip away as you are trying to brainstorm ideas and get agreement on them.
